Hi gang - Just put the dash in and noticed the Speedo won't zero out - stuck at 65 MPH. When I spin the cable one way it will move past towards 70, etc....but when I spin the cable the other way it sounds like it's hitting a "stop." Any suggestions on root cause? Dreading taking the dash back out....thanks! TJ
